Sat 1822257538137139

decimal
617806.38137139
degree
0°197806′910″38137139‴
percentile
86.77416857817252%
name
ayczgyifelq
cycle
0
epoch
2
period
306
block
617806
offset
38137139
timestamp
rarity
common